## How to Backup Data on Your Old Android Device

Before commencing the data transfer, it’s crucial to back up all information on your old device. Google provides an integrated backup solution that automatically secures your contacts, call histories, texts, and configurations (including Do Not Disturb settings) to Google Drive, making data restoration on your new phone a breeze.

### Steps to Back Up Your Android Device:
1. **Open Settings**: Navigate to the settings menu from your apps or Quick Settings.
2. **Scroll Down**: Move to the bottom of the page.
3. **Select System**: If this option isn’t visible, head to the **Google** section and tap **Manage Backup**.
4. **Tap Backup**: Make sure that **Backup by Google One** is activated.
5. **Back Up Now**: Hit the **Back up now** button to synchronize your most recent data to Google Drive.

> **Pro Tip**: Visit [contacts.google.com](https://contacts.google.com) to confirm that all your contacts have been backed up to your Google account. The contacts displayed here will be accessible on your new device.

After your data is backed up, you’re set to initiate the setup of your new phone.

## How to Transfer Photos and Videos to Your New Android Device

Google Photos serves as an excellent resource for saving your images and videos. It provides two backup settings: **Original Quality** (the top resolution) and **Storage Saver** (which minimizes file size while maintaining decent quality). However, Google Photos has ended unlimited storage, so you might need to consider acquiring a Google One subscription if you run low on space.

### Steps to Back Up Photos and Videos:
1. **Open Google Photos**: Start the app on your device.
2. **Tap Your Profile Picture**: Located in the top-right corner.
3. **Go to Photos Settings**: Access the settings menu.
4. **Select Backup & Sync**: Ensure the **Back up & sync** option is enabled.
5. **Choose Backup Mode**: Select the backup mode as **High Quality** or **Original Quality**.

After your photos and videos are backed up, they will automatically sync to your new device when you log in with your Google account.

## How to Restore Data and Settings to Your New Android Device

Now that you’ve backed up your data, it’s time to configure your new phone. Google’s setup procedure simplifies the data transfer from your old device. Keep your old phone nearby, so refrain from resetting it just yet.

### Steps to Restore Data:
1. **Select Language**: Choose your language and tap **Start** on the welcome screen.
2. **Connect to Wi-Fi**: Join your home Wi-Fi network.
3. **Copy Apps & Data**: Tap **Next** to begin the data migration from your old device.
4. **Connect Phones**: Employ a USB-C to USB-C cable to link your old phone to the new one.
5. **Follow Prompts**: Choose the data you wish to transfer and adhere to the on-screen guidance.

> **Note**: This approach will migrate your Google account, applications, Wi-Fi credentials, and other settings. Following the transfer, Google Play will automatically restore your applications in the background, which might take some time depending on your internet speed.

## Using Samsung Smart Switch for Android-to-Android Transfers

If you’re upgrading to a Samsung Galaxy device, Samsung’s **Smart Switch** application simplifies the process further. Smart Switch can transfer all your information, including settings, messages, call logs, and even your home screen arrangement.

### Steps to Use Samsung Smart Switch:
1. **Install Smart Switch**: Many Samsung devices come with Smart Switch pre-installed. If it’s not, download it from the Google Play Store.
2. **Connect Phones**: Utilize a USB-C cable to link your old and new Samsung devices.
3. **Follow Instructions**: Smart Switch will walk you through selecting and transferring your data.

> **Bonus**: Smart Switch maintains your home screen layout and configurations, so your new device will resemble your old one perfectly.
